What affects the price

Building an ADU is a major project, and the final bill depends on a few key things. Site prep is a big factor; if your land is sloped or needs extensive utility connections, costs go up. The materials you choose—from siding to kitchen finishes—also change the math significantly. What are the disadvantages of ADUs in California?

Some disadvantages of ADUs in California can include increased utility costs and potential impacts on existing yard space. Parking requirements in Stockton can also be a consideration, depending on the specific location. Discussing these with a local expert is recommended.

What are the rules for ADUs in California?

California has statewide laws promoting ADUs, but local cities like Stockton have their own specific zoning and development standards. These rules often cover lot size, setbacks, parking requirements, and height limits. A professional familiar with Stockton's ordinances will ensure compliance.
